1 μg = 0.001 mg. This means that there are 0.001 milligrams in one microgram. For example, how many milligrams are in 3000 micrograms? = 3000 x 0.001 = 3 mg. Therefore, there are 3 milligrams in 3000 micrograms. A milligram is abbreviated as "mg" and it is equivalent to a millionth of a kilogram.

The conversion between Vitamin D units and micrograms (or milligrams) is easy: From Micrograms to IU: 1 microgram (mcg) equals 40 IU. Similarly, going from IU to mcg: 1 IU equals 0.025 mcg (micrograms) The most common strengths you will see are: Vitamin D 400 IU = 10 mcg (0.01 milligrams)Aug 2, 2023 · Total Moderate dose: 2 to 20 mcg/kg. Standards for sera are held at the State Serum Institute, Copenhagen, the National Institute for Medical Research at Mill Hill, UK. and by the WHO. An International Unit is defined as a particular quantity of the standard preparation (one IU of tetanus antitoxin is 0.1547 mg of a preparation held in Copenhagen).

Labeling Units of Measure. μg = mcg: microgram. One millionth of one gram. mg: milligram. One thousandth of one gram. IU: International Unit is a measure of biological activity and is different for each substance. RAE: Retinol Activity Equivalent. DFE: Dietary Folate Equivalent.
